Bert Fink Named Chief Creative Officer for MTI Europe
by Nicole Rosky - Nov 3, 2015


Bert Fink will join Music Theatre International (MTI) as Chief Creative Officer for MTI Europe, it was announced today by Drew Cohen, President and Chief Operating Officer of MTI Worldwide.

Imagem Music Group Expands with R&H Theatricals Europe
by Robert Diamond - Sep 6, 2012


The Imagem Music Group, owner of some of the world's most popular musicals including The Sound of Music and The King and I, is expanding its US-based theatrical licensing division, R&H Theatricals, with the creation of a European branch headquartered in the London offices of Imagem UK. R&H Theatricals Europe will represent a catalogue of Broadway evergreens (South Pacific, Oklahoma!) and contemporary classics (Footloose, White Christmas) throughout the UK and across the European market.

2012-2013 Tony Awards Nominating Committee Revealed
by Robert Diamond - Jun 18, 2012


The Tony Awards Nominating Committee is a rotating group of up to 35 theatre professionals selected by the Tony Awards Administration Committee. Nominators serve for overlapping three-year terms. They are asked to see every new Broadway production and then meet each year shortly after the Tony eligibility deadline. They determine the nominations based on secret ballots supervised by an accounting firm. The results are announced early the following morning.
